When we're on the road, rather than always picking an airport that is close to our destination, we try to see if there might be another airport that would better fit our travel plans.<1> To help with your planning, the following list of airports is organized by type and proximity to North Branch.
Please keep in mind that these airports were chosen based on their air-distance from North Branch. You should check the map and see how accessible they are when considering one airport over another.
